Configuring SCOPIA 400 Chassis Parameters
78
SCOPIA 400/1000 Gateway User Guide
Table 3-3
System Elements
Element
Information section
Temperature threshold
Status section
Description
This section provides the following information about the
SCOPIA chassis hardware:
Serial number—Displays the serial number of the
chassis.
Part number—Displays the part number of the
chassis.
System configuration—Identifies the hardware
configuration the chassis uses.
In this section, you can set the following temperature values
that the chassis uses to trigger changes in the ambient
temperature status:
Low—Enter the temperature value at which the
Gateway module turns off the chassis temperature
alarm. The value is measured in Celsius.
High—Enter the temperature value above which the
Gateway module turns on the chassis temperature
alarm. The value is measured in Celsius.
These LEDs provide information about chassis operation.
Power—This LED lights green for normal
operation. It lights red when one power supply fails.
Alarm—This LED lights green for normal
operation. It lights red when a system failure occurs.
Fans—This LED lights green for normal operation.
It lights red when one or more fans fail. A message
then appears indicating which fan has failed.
Temperature—This LED lights green for normal
operation. It is red when the chassis determines that
the ambient temperature rises above the high
temperature threshold. The LED blinks when the
falling ambient temperature crosses the high
threshold to within five degrees of the high
threshold.
